The beautiful European seaside town that’s ‘just like Ibiza’ – but much cheaper | Travel News | Travel

If you’re dreaming of Ibiza’s shimmering waters, glitzy nightlife, and bohemian vibes but without the sky-high price tag, a hidden gem on the Adriatic coast could be your next affordable escape.

Tivat, a coastal town in Montenegro, is being hailed as the budget-friendly answer to Spain’s ultra-popular Balearic island. According to Airbnb research, Tivat offers “luxury for less” and is fast becoming a hotspot for Britons seeking sun-soaked glamour without the Ibiza price surge.

“A picturesque coastal town with a Monaco-meets-Ibiza allure, Tivat offers vibrant, fun-filled settings that deliver the same bohemian charm as the White Isle,” said an Airbnb spokesperson.

Located in the Bay of Kotor, Tivat has undergone a multimillion-dollar transformation. Its once-industrial naval base is now home to Porto Montenegro, a dazzling marina packed with sleek superyachts, upscale restaurants, and lively bars.

The chic waterfront promenade has drawn comparisons to Monaco, with Tripadvisor reviewers dubbing it “Little Monaco.”

Despite its rising star status, Tivat remains surprisingly affordable. A cold local beer costs just €2.50 (£2.10), and a cappuccino comes in at under £3, making it an attractive alternative for sun-seekers watching their wallets.

Beyond the marina’s glitz, the town offers cultural gems like the Maritime Heritage Museum and tranquil beaches such as Plaza Ponta, a quiet, natural stretch of shoreline praised by tourists for its clear waters and peaceful atmosphere.

And the appeal doesn’t end at Tivat’s borders. Kotor, with its dramatic bay and medieval old town, is only a 30-minute drive away, while the baroque seaside town of Perast, often likened to Venice, is just 45 minutes away.

With average summer temperatures hitting 30°C and sunshine from April through October, Tivat offers a long season of seaside bliss. Budget airlines including easyJet and Jet2 now run direct flights from the UK to Tivat, while the capital, Podgorica, is just a short transfer away.

As Ibiza grapples with overtourism, protests, and soaring prices, Tivat is emerging as a Mediterranean escape that blends style, culture, and affordability, all in just over three hours’ flight from the UK.
